Descent: Viaggi nelle Tenebre (Seconda Edizione)
One player acts as the treacherous overlord while up to four others play heroes who undertake quests across caves, ruins, dungeons, and cursed forests. Players move miniatures on modular double-sided map tiles, fight monsters using a dice-based combat system, and resolve attacks with pooled dice and surge symbols that trigger additional effects. The game runs as an out-of-the-box campaign: heroes gain experience, learn new skills, and customize loadouts between shorter quests that provide natural stopping points. The overlord manages enemy spawns and special powers via a streamlined control system while rules simplify line of sight, setup, and bookkeeping for faster play.

Nevest6,4 I think my general problem with games like this is that they’re taking the least interesting part of a role-playing game (the combat system) and turning that into the entire game. Even just looking at combat, in a full role-playing game, the interesting thing is when players think outside of the box and do something unforseen to take advantage of the environment or use an ability in a novel way. You lose all of that in these stripped-down dungeon crawlers with some pasted on story at the beginning and end of each mission. Mechanically, this game is ok. Each character we’ve played so far does feel different and you will do much better if you use each character’s strengths and play off of each others’ abilities. Some of the rules are very fiddly though and could be streamlined. There are some balance problems with some missions and some monsters being much easier/harder than others. It would be nice if there was some mechanism to balance a mission in-progress to make it closer throughout. Instead, most of the mechanisms serve to make the winners stronger. This game shares a common problem with many co-op games. It can easily devolve into one of the hero players quarterbacking all of the hero turns. Over time, as the heroes level up, it can get harder to hold all of the info for every hero in one person’s head, but it’s certainly do-able.
Evan3,5 It's a pseudo-RPG/Adventure game, where players compete against the GM player to try to complete a scenario goal first. This game has a lot of cool looking minis, and I enjoy the way players increase in skills and powers as they invest experience points into their various skill trees. Frequently base game quests are hard to understand the rules to, leading to game play effecting mistakes being made. This improves with expansion quest book, in particular the [Descent: Journeys in the Dark (Second Edition) – Labyrinth of Ruin](/g/descent-journeys-in-the-dark-second-edition-labyrinth-of-ruin) quests seemed very well thought out. Frustrating that there are minis included for characters, for monster groups, but not for bosses. Boss monster minis are sold separately. I wish hero players could invest points into multiple professions. There's so much content in this game, it feels a little overwhelming that you can play the same class and have a near infinite character/skilltree combinations to pick from. For a player like me who enjoys exploring game systems, locking a character into one tree of skills for however many sessions it takes to beat a campaign feels overly restrictive. I wore on this game as I wore myself out of 1 vs many games, and dungeon crawl games generally. When I do crawl, I've been more interested in playing fully co-op games with less dice luck. Part of the disconnect for Descent 2 in particular is that most games are more of a race to the end and less of a crawl. Often monsters just serve to delay and distract the heroes rather than being something to overcome. If I'm tracing line of sight to a space that contains a figure, does that figure block line of sight to that space?
Yes — if the line passes through any blocked space (a space containing a figure or obstacle), including the target space itself, that space is not in line of sight. (p.3)
Are two spaces separated by the black edge of a map tile (a wall) considered adjacent or in line of sight?
No — spaces separated by a tile edge (the black border) are not adjacent and the wall blocks both movement and line of sight. (p.3)
If my figure is Stunned, do I lose my whole turn?
No — the Stunned condition forces the figure to use its first action to discard the Condition card, and after discarding it may still perform its second action; if stunned after already using the first action, the second action must be used to discard. (p.3)
What happens when a hero is knocked out during his turn — does his turn end and can he act after standing up?
If a hero is defeated during his own turn, that turn immediately ends; likewise, if a hero performs a stand up action, his turn ends immediately so he cannot take further actions (or spend fatigue for movement) that turn. (p.3)
Can I interrupt a move action to perform another move, and what does a card that tells me to 'end your move action' do?
Yes — you may interrupt a move action to start another move action and both are simply move actions (no separate tracking needed); if a card tells you to end your move action, all move actions end and you lose any unspent movement points, and if you want to suffer fatigue for extra movement during a move you must declare exactly when you do so. (p.3)
If my Necromancer is defeated, is his Reanimate removed, and can a familiar be activated while the hero is knocked out?
No — familiars (including Reanimate) are not removed when their hero is defeated and are only defeated when they suffer damage equal to their Health; a familiar can be activated while its hero is knocked out but only before the hero stands up, and a familiar can be activated only once per round. (pp.3–4)
